Steve Madden Announces Fourth Quarter and Full Year 2015 Results and Provides Initial Fiscal Year 2016 Sales and EPS Guidance
February 24, 2016 6:59 AM ESTLONG ISLAND CITY, N.Y.--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- Steve Madden (Nasdaq: SHOO), a leading designer and marketer of fashion footwear and accessories for women, men and children, today announced financial results for the fourth quarter and full year ended December 31, 2015, and provided initial fiscal year 2016 sales and EPS guidance.
For the Fourth Quarter 2015:
Net sales increased 0.5% to $344.3 million compared to $342.6 million in the same period of 2014. Gross margin expanded 180 basis points to 36.1% as compared to 34.3% in the same period last year.... More
